HOME AGAIN On these stones your father labored To reduce living moments to chiseled Dates, names, and Masonic emblems. And what did he have to show for it? Swollen liver and vengeful wife. On this town you labored to reduce Humanity to Altamont and Dixieland. And what did you have to show for it? An unforgiving town and a hurt family. Now, all lies stone-deep in the calm Of daylight and dead; mountain empty Of your mortal flesh; the air above The grave empty of angel. But I know what is here, what was. This is holy, this ground which holds The germ of my launching. Winter comes Soon, old friend, and I breathe the fall airTalisman of your talent. — John P. McAfee John P. McAfee, originally from Texas, now lives in Asheville, N. C, and teaches there. 1 ...
